I must admit that I never knew before that there were two versions
of this familiar microphone. I can understand that as metal become more
precious designs to conserve it became more common. For instance the
notorious celluloid labels on Lionel J-36 keys. My one and only T-17
barely works. Noisy and the cord has rotted badly. I opened it recently
to see if I could repair it and decided just to leave it as an artifact.
I have an RS-38A carbon mic which is mint and works like new. I
suppose mostly a difference in storage but I have no idea of the actual
age or provenance of either one. I can't even remember where I bought
them now although it was undoubtedly in some local surplus store. My
T-17 was built by Shure. I don't have it handy so can't look for a
contract number on it. I think its a metal case version. I will look
later and post something.
